    I fish the River in the Pike Island pool up to Stauton. The River produces the biggest crappie around in the late fall through the early spring. a 17"er isn't that uncommon.
    I mainly fish Berlin, Mosquito, West Branch, Milton and a few other smaller lakes. Crappie have been slow but are starting to pick up on the flats.
